What Does a Sleep Therapist Do?


A rest specialist focuses on identifying and treating sleep problems. These specialists are often learnt cognitive-behavioral strategies and various other healing approaches to enhance rest patterns and overall wellness. They resolve both the behavior and mental elements of sleep disorders, making their strategy all natural and extensive.


Key duties of a sleep therapist include:



  • Conducting evaluations to identify sleep conditions.

  • Creating individualized treatment plans for problems such as rest wake condition.

  • Using cognitive-behavioral therapy for sleep problems (CBT-I).

  • Attending to way of life aspects that contribute to poor rest.

  • Collaborating care with various other experts like rest disorder medical professionals or general practitioners.


Typical Sleep Disorders Treated by a Sleep Therapist


A rest therapist is equipped to handle a wide variety of sleep-related concerns. Allow's take a better check out some of the most typical problems they can help with:


1. Sleep Wake Disorder


This condition entails an inequality between your body's biological rhythm and the outside setting, frequently causing problems in preserving a regular rest schedule. A rest specialist can assist you realign your body clock with light therapy, behavioral modifications, and relaxation methods.


2. Narcolepsy Treatment


Narcolepsy is a neurological condition that triggers extreme daytime drowsiness and abrupt muscular tissue weak point (cataplexy). A rest specialist jobs carefully with a sleep medicine doctor to create a monitoring strategy, which may include behavioral strategies and medication changes.


3. Parasomnia Treatment


Parasomnias are turbulent rest actions, such as sleepwalking, problems, or rest talking. While these behaviors can be unsettling, they are treatable. A rest specialist typically utilizes techniques to recognize triggers and lower episodes, especially with sleep talking therapy or other targeted therapies.


4. Hypersomnia Treatment


Hypersomnia entails extreme sleepiness throughout the day, even after a complete night's remainder. A rest therapist reviews prospective underlying reasons, such as way of life elements, clinical conditions, or emotional anxiety, and develops approaches to handle too much sleepiness.


5. Insomnia


One of one of the most learn more here common rest disorders, sleeplessness is characterized by problem dropping or staying asleep. CBT-I, supplied by an sleeping disorders medical professional or sleep therapist, is just one of the most efficient therapies available.


Exactly How Sleep Therapists Approach Treatment


The job of a rest therapist includes numerous evidence-based techniques customized to the special demands of each client. Below are several of the most common techniques made use of in rest treatment:


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y for Insomnia (CBT-I)


CBT-I is a cornerstone of sleep treatment. It concentrates on recognizing and changing thought patterns and habits that disrupt sleep. For example, you could:



  • Develop a regular going to bed regimen.

  • Learn leisure techniques to take care of pre-sleep stress and anxiety.

  • Reframe unfavorable thoughts about sleep.


Way Of Life and Behavioral Modifications


A rest therapist might advise modifications to your everyday routines, such as:



  • Avoiding high levels of caffeine or square meals before bed.

  • Establishing a relaxing bedtime regimen.

  • Restricting screen time in the evening.


Education and Support


Many patients gain from recognizing their problem. A sleep specialist gives sources and assistance to empower you to handle your rest issues effectively. This is particularly helpful for disorders like rest wake condition or narcolepsy, where ongoing education and learning can enhance outcomes.


Cooperation with Other Specialists


Sometimes, a sleep specialist works along with other specialists, such as sleep problem physicians or an insomnia medical professional, to guarantee a comprehensive technique to treatment. For instance, a rest medicine medical professional may supply medications while the specialist concentrates on behavioral modifications.

Self-Help Tips to Complement Sleep Therapy


While working with a sleep specialist, you can embrace these self-help methods to enhance your sleep wellness:



  • Stick to a Sleep Schedule: Go to bed and get up at the same time everyday, even on weekends.

  • Develop a Sleep-Friendly Environment: Keep your bed room cool, dark, and quiet.

  • Exercise Relaxation Techniques: Deep breathing, reflection, or progressive muscular tissue leisure can help you take a break prior to bed.

  • Monitor Your Sleep Habits: Keep a journal to track your rest patterns and identify triggers.

  • Restriction Stimulants: Avoid high levels of caffeine and nicotine in the hours leading up to going to bed.
